JEA reviewing CityVet application to operate in St. Johns County

The veterinary practice is planned at the St. Johns Commons shopping center.

A St. Johns County veterinary space once reported to be Arista Advanced Pet Care may open under a related brand, CityVet, when it begins operations.

JEA is reviewing a service availability request made by a CityVet employee at the same address where a project identified as “Arista Jacksonville Vet” was issued a $2.8 million build-out permit Dec. 31 for 2220 County Road 210 W., Suite 201.

The 22,027-square-foot space is at the St. John’s Commons shopping center, next to an Aldi that opened Feb. 26.

Both companies operate under parent company Affinity Veterinary Partners and offer similar services. 

CityVet focuses on general practice, grooming and boarding, while Arista specializes in 24/7 emergency and specialty referral services. On their websites, both say they aim to provide autonomy to veterinary teams without corporate protocols or quotas.

CityVet was founded in 1999 and has more than 75 locations in Colorado, Florida, Georgia, Indiana, North Carolina, Oklahoma, Virginia and Washington, D.C.

Founded in 2024, Arista has one location in Georgia and another in Texas.

Calls to CityVet were not returned.
